Srinagar City Gets Brighter: Rooftop Solar Systems Under PM Surya Ghar Yojana
This positive development for the "City of Gardens," Srinagar is embracing renewable energy with the rollout of the PM Surya Ghar Yojana. Residents across the region are now eligible to benefit from incentives towards installing photovoltaic setups on their homes. The scheme aims to reduce electricity bills , promote environmental sustainability, and foster self-reliance in power generation . The program is expected to brighten homes while contributing to a greener, more sustainable Srinagar for generations to come, providing access for a cleaner and cheaper power solution.

Pradhan Mantri Suryaghar Yojana Accelerates Solar Adoption in Srinagar & Beyond
The implementation of the PM Surya Ghar Yojana is rapidly driving greater solar adoption across Srinagar and surrounding areas, impacting households throughout Jammu and Kashmir. Previously hesitant residents are now opting for rooftop solar installations, spurred by the scheme's attractive financial subsidies and simplified registration . The initiative aims to empower citizens with clean, affordable electricity while reducing reliance on conventional power sources. Preliminary data suggest a noteworthy rise in solar demand, prompting local businesses to expand their offerings and creating new job opportunities in the renewable energy sector. This momentum is expected to continue as awareness grows and more families realize the financial and environmental advantages of adopting rooftop solar power.
